Soft Pretzel Bites

Ideal bite-sized soft pretzels! Prior to baking, customize them with your preferred toppings such as salt, poppy seeds, sesame seeds, dried shallots, dried onions, and more. Pair them with cheese sauce or any dipping sauce you fancy.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Additional Time 1 hour 15 minutes
Total Time 2 hours
Course Snack
Cuisine world cuisine
Servings 16
Calories 166 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1 ½ cups water
  • 6 tablespoons butter, melted
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ar
  • 1 (.25 ounce) package active dry yeast
  • 2 ½ teaspoons kosher salt
  • 4 cups all-purpose flour, or more as needed
  • 1 teaspoon vegetable oil
  • 3 quarts cold water
  • ½ cup baking soda
  • cooking spray
  • 1 egg
  • 1 tablespoon water

Instructions
 

  • Place 1 1/2 cups water, butter, brown sugar, yeast, and salt in the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the hook attachment. Mix until well combined. Let sit for about 5 minutes.
  • Turn mixer on low speed and add 4 cups flour, 1 cup at a time. Add additional 1/2 cup flour if dough appears sticky. Increase speed to medium and knead until dough is smooth and pulls away from the sides of the bowl, 4 to 5 minutes. Sprinkle in more flour if dough still seems a little tacky.
  • Oil a large mixing bowl. Add the ball of dough. Cover with plastic wrap and let rise in a warm place for about 1 hour.
  •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C). Grease a sheet pan with cooking spray.
  • Bring 3 quarts water to a boil in a large saucepan. Slowly add baking soda and return to a boil.
  • Meanwhile, remove dough from the bowl, flatten into a disc shape, and cut into 8 wedges. Roll each wedge into a 24-inch rope. Cut each rope into 1-inch pieces.
  • Drop batches of dough pieces into the boiling water for about 35 seconds. Remove to the prepared sheet pan. Beat egg with 1 tablespoon water; brush over the tops of each boiled dough piece. Repeat with remaining dough.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own, 14 to 16 minutes. Cool slightly before serving.

Notes

Nutrition data for this recipe includes the full amount of baking soda. The actual amount of baking soda consumed will vary.
